3 competitions conclude at Ajman fest

Held as part of Ajman Tourism Development Department’s (ATDD) Ajman Sea Festival and organised in cooperation with Dubai International Marine Club, the Jet Ski Drag Race, Flyboard Championship and Dragon Boat Race concluded. More than 100 contestants of various nationalities participated in the competitions at Marina 1 from Oct.25-26.

Saud Al Jasmi, Head of Events at ATDD, and Hezaim Al Gemzi, the Director of Dubai International Marine Club’s Sports/Race Department, honoured the winners of the three races. The total value of the prizes for the Drag Race, which was held in the UAE for the first time, was approximately Dhs92,000, while the prizes for the Flyboard Championship amounted to Dhs34,000, in addition ATDD honoured the competitors of Dragon Boat Race.

Saud Al Jasmi said, “ATDD attaches great importance to marine sports; they are very popular and they help to promote tourism in Ajman. The department was keen to offer a variety of marine activities and events during the Sea Festival including the UAE’s first Drag Race, which was organised in response to strong demand from fans.”

He added that before the start of the competitions, the Organising Committee provided contestants with information about the courses, detailed explanations of the regulations and reports on sea and wind conditions.

In the Professional Category of the Flyboard Championship, first place winner Manea Habib Al Marzouki, who was awarded Dhs10,000, followed by Mohammed Ishaq in second place which was awarded Dhs 7,000 and Majid Habib Al Marzouki in third place awarded Dhs5,000. In the Beginners Category, Salem Mohsen won first place, Jamal Al Janahi came in second place and Saif Sultan was the third-place winner.

In the Jet Ski Drag Race’s Super Stock Category, Salman Younis Al Awadi won first place and awarded Dhs20,000, Ali Al Lenjawi took second place awarded Dhs10,000 and Amer Abdulrazak Huwair came in third place and awarded Dhs5,000. In the Open Class Category, Salman Younis Al Awadi won first place and awarded with Seadoo Spark - JetSki, Mohammed Abdulghaffar Al Awadi came in second and awarded Dhs15,000, Ali Mohammed Al Lenjawi came in third place awarded Dhs7,000.

In the Dragon Boat Race, Titans 1 won first place in the Mixed Category, while Dragon and AUH Warriors won second place in the Women’s Category and Phoenix took third place in the Mixed Category (for men and women).
